Both types are able to continuously cut straight, irregular, and curved lines scribed on a workpiece and are usually used to cut template patterns for trimming the sheet metal, duct work, auto body work, and aircraft structural repair. The main difference between heavy- and light-duty power shears lies in thickness and hardness of a metal sheet.

Heavy-duty power shears are capable of cutting soft sheet steel up to #6 gauge, but they are mostly used (by maintenance shops, for instance) for cutting up to #12 gauge sheet metal. Our cutting tools range includes shears that can efficiently cut even the sheet metal that is milder and a bit thicker than the standard sheet metal for these power shears. Light-duty power shears are capable of cutting #14 gauge sheet metal and thinner. As they weigh even less than heavy-duty power cutting tools, they are much more facile in handling.
